4450 WEST 8TH AVENUE, VANCOUVER

Type: Two-bedroom, two-bathroom townhouse

Size: 1,246 sq. ft.

B.C. Assessment: $1,366,000

Listed for: $1,398,000

Sold for: $1,381,000

Sold on: March 2

Days on market: Eight

Listing agent: John Dean at Engel & Volkers Vancouver

Buyers agent: John Dean at Engel & Volkers Vancouver

The big sell: Sasamat Gardens is a 41-unit developmen­t in the heart of Point Grey, near the stores on West 10th Avenue. The complex was built in 2006, but this home was updated last year and features granite countertop­s and a stainless-steel appliance package. The home has vaulted ceilings, chandelier lighting in the dining area and a well-equipped galley-style kitchen. The master bedroom and ensuite bathroom are on this main level, while the downstairs has the second bedroom and bathroom as well as the entrance foyer. A 90-square-foot storage room and two undergroun­d parking stalls are included. The monthly maintenanc­e fee is $343.26. Pets and rentals are allowed with restrictio­ns.

1506 — 11967 80 AVENUE, DELTA

Type: Two-bedroom, two-bathroom apartment

Size: 771 sq. ft.

B.C. Assessment: $428,000

Listed for: $549,500

Sold for: $540,000

Sold on: Feb. 27

Days on market: 14

Listing agent: Gurjeet Gill at Coldwell Banker Universe Realty

Buyers agent: Gurjeet Gill at Coldwell Banker Universe Realty

The big sell: North Delta’s Scottsdale district is home to the Delta Rise building, which was built in 2017 with 317 units on 37 floors, making it the community’s tallest building. It features more than half an acre of green space and amenities on the rooftop park with an outdoor barbecue pit, a playground, vegetable plots, a fitness area, Zen garden, brook and a putting green. This corner unit has a northeast facing aspect with Mount Baker and North Shore Mountain views. Laminate floors flow through the apartment, while the open-concept kitchen has top-of-the-line stainless-steel KitchenAid appliances, including a French-door refrigerat­or, a stacked Maytag washer and dryer, quartz countertop­s and LED under-cabinet lighting. There are built-in closet organizers, in-suite storage and a wraparound deck. The monthly maintenanc­e fee is $218.41 and pets and rentals are permitted.

1731 HARBOUR DRIVE, COQUITLAM

Type: Four-bedroom, three-bathroom detached

Size: 2,628 sq. ft.

B.C. Assessment: $1,303,000

Listed for: $1,388,000

Sold for: $1,405,000

Sold on: Feb. 19

Days on market: Five

Listing agent: Rory Clipsham at Coldwell Banker Westburn Realty

Buyers agent: Dennis Kwon at Team 3000 Realty

The big sell: This updated family residence is on a 66-by-120-foot lot that backs on to Selkirk Park in Coquitlam’s Harbour Chines neighbourh­ood. The rancher-plusbaseme­nt home was built in 1960 with the main floor comprising the principal reception rooms on one side and the sleeping quarters with three bedrooms on the other. It has Brazilian hardwood floors and a gourmet kitchen with maple cabinets, premium brand appliances, a tiled backsplash and granite breakfast bar. The residence also has heated floors in the kitchen and bathroom, newer windows, a central vacuum floor sweep, a gas fireplace and French doors that lead to an entertainm­ent-sized deck with views across the nature-inspired garden. The walkout basement has a 21-foot-long family room, attached workshop and storage and one-bedroom self-contained suite with a separate entry and a second laundry area. There is covered parking for two cars and a driveway for additional vehicles.
